What Employees Think About Work From Home
Even earlier than the coronavirus pandemic, companies supported rising numbers of distant workers and supplied versatile schedules as benefits. And the demand for each was solely increasing. Suddenly, just about everybody who can work remotely is - so what are they actually saying about the experience? CareerBuilder asked, "If you had the option to work remotely, publish-pandemic, would you? " About 9% stated definitively no, 12% mentioned they’d want a mix of office time and remote work, and 78% said yes, they would need to work from home (which may embody a combine, but didn’t specify). Furthermore, small tasks may require an additional "push," however taking a break can truly help restore motivation for lengthy-time period initiatives as well. First, schedule breaks into your daily routine. These can take the form of a 20- minute stroll, an precise lunch break, a phone call with household/buddies, or a midday trip to the gym (depending on proximity). Second, if you’re in a state of stream and making great progress in your duties and/or initiatives, don’t cease, even if you’re approaching a chosen break period. These times of increased focus are what you ought to be aiming for legit work from home guide each day, and reducing them quick defeats the purpose of seeking them in the primary place. Pro tip: micro-breaking the hours of your workday is a great strategy to measure productiveness and progress in between longer durations of "rest." In many workplaces and dwelling-offices, the pomodoro technique has grown in recognition. Essentially, that is 25 minute durations of intense, "heads down" work adopted by 5 Step Formula System minute breaks.

Research by psychologist Julianne Holt-Lunstad at Brigham Young University has indicated that social integration is without doubt one of the strongest predictors of longevity. Similarly, a examine carried out by researchers at the University of Chicago discovered that routine social interactions can profit psychological health. Workplace relationships additionally play a task in employee dedication. A 2018 research by Sigal G. Barsade discovered that workers experiencing larger loneliness reported feeling much less dedicated to their employers and coworkers. Remote work, by decreasing opportunities for informal interaction, can hinder the development of office friendships. Concerns have been raised that distant work might negatively have an effect on career progression and workplace relationships. However, a 2007 study found no total detrimental results on the quality of office relationships or career outcomes amongst distant staff. Actually, remote work was related to improvements in worker-supervisor relationships, and job satisfaction was partly linked to the standard of those relationships. The study famous that only excessive-depth remote work-outlined as working remotely more than 2.5 days per week-was associated with weaker relationships among coworkers, though it also diminished work-family battle.
